1. Sound reduction

Standard single-speed pool pumps are known to be loud, even when running at lower speeds. Variable-speed pumps produce sound levels of around 45 decibels. The sound level is like having a lively conversation with a friend or a dishwasher.


2. Decrease your energy usage

A variable-speed pool pump has different settings to reduce the amount of work and is compatible with other pool equipment like cleaners, heaters, and more. This helps increase your energy savings by using different settings on your pool pump.


3. Programmable features

Variable-speed pumps allow pool owners to find the right speed for filtering, cleaning, heating, and other maintenance features of their pool.


4. Better filtration

Using a variable-speed pump helps you find the right flow rate for your pool’s filter system and keep your pool sanitized.


5. Longer warranty

Most variable-speed pool pump manufacturers offer two and three-year warranties for the equipment. This includes parts and labor when you are buying the pool pump from a trusted manufacturer.


6. Less time spent on maintenance

Variable-speed pumps run longer when programmed on a lower setting, but it reduces the amount of stress put on the equipment. This helps your pool’s pump and other parts last longer because they are not being overworked or exposed to high amounts of heat.
